Bandarawela is a scenic hill town that nestles at the heart of Sri Lanka’s tea region in the Badulla district. The pleasing climate and verdant scenery make it an all-year-round getaway destination. The erstwhile colonial town offers a balanced mix of cultural attractions and natural wonders worthy of exploration. While the hilly terrain is a magnet for hikers, history buffs are drawn to the ancient Buddhist rock-cut temple in the vicinity. Meanwhile, the many picturesque waterfalls that sit tucked into remote, wooded glens, ensure a choice of enjoyable day excursions. Given the region’s longstanding tryst with tea, a glimpse into the process of making the fragrant brew with a trip to a tea factory is a must.
